What does the activation of a deluge sprinkler system indicate?

Explanation:
The activation of a deluge sprinkler system indicates immediate water flow to large areas for fire suppression. Deluge systems are specifically designed to release water over a wide area rapidly, making them particularly effective for combating fires that may spread quickly or involve flammable materials. Unlike standard sprinkler systems that activate individually at the location of a fire, deluge systems have open nozzles and are triggered simultaneously, ensuring a large volume of water is applied to the affected area to control or extinguish the fire quickly. This characteristic makes them essential for certain high-hazard environments, such as industrial settings or areas where a rapid response is crucial to prevent extensive damage.
